Medicine Theater bridges its own unique physical style of play along with exercises and games first developed by Viola Spolin (the internationally recognized originator of Chicago's The Second City Improv). Medicine Theater draws on elements of improv, ensemble building techniques, character and story creation, intention setting, meditation, yoga, and earth-based ritual in order to liberate our body, tap into our intuitive knowing and awaken our creative play which is our birthright; giving a voice back to the parts of us that have been voiceless.
Medicine Theater offers a variety of programs for adults and youth.
